The factored form of the expression 15x³ + 45x²y - 30x, factoring out the GCF is 15x(x² + 3xy - 2).
What is the factored form of the given expression?
Given the expression in the question:
15x³ + 45x²y - 30x
To factor out the greatest common factor (GCF) from the expression 15x³ + 45x²y - 30x, first, we need to identify the common terms in each of the coefficients.
15x³ + 45x²y - 30x
The GCF for the coefficients is 15x because it's the largest number that evenly divides each coefficient.
Hence, factor out 15x from each term:
15x³ + 45x²y - 30x
15x(x² + 3xy - 2)
Therefore, the factored form is 15x(x² + 3xy - 2).
